.gradient-orb[data-astro-cid-bbe6dxrz]{position:absolute;border-radius:50%;filter:blur(80px);opacity:.4;animation:float-orb 20s infinite ease-in-out}.gradient-orb-1[data-astro-cid-bbe6dxrz]{width:500px;height:500px;background:linear-gradient(135deg,#3b82f6,#06b6d4);top:-250px;left:-200px;animation-delay:0s}.gradient-orb-2[data-astro-cid-bbe6dxrz]{width:400px;height:400px;background:linear-gradient(135deg,#06b6d4,#0ea5e9);top:-100px;right:-150px;animation-delay:3s}.gradient-orb-3[data-astro-cid-bbe6dxrz]{width:600px;height:600px;background:linear-gradient(135deg,#0ea5e9,#3b82f6);bottom:-300px;left:10%;animation-delay:5s}.gradient-orb-4[data-astro-cid-bbe6dxrz]{width:450px;height:450px;background:linear-gradient(135deg,#6366f1,#3b82f6);bottom:-200px;right:20%;animation-delay:7s}@keyframes float-orb{0%,to{transform:translate(0) scale(1)}25%{transform:translate(30px,-30px) scale(1.1)}50%{transform:translate(-20px,20px) scale(.9)}75%{transform:translate(40px,10px) scale(1.05)}}.particle-container[data-astro-cid-bbe6dxrz]{position:absolute;inset:0;overflow:hidden;pointer-events:none}.particle[data-astro-cid-bbe6dxrz]{position:absolute;width:4px;height:4px;background:linear-gradient(135deg,#3b82f6,#06b6d4);border-radius:50%;opacity:.3;animation:float-particle 15s infinite ease-in-out}.particle-1[data-astro-cid-bbe6dxrz]{top:10%;left:20%;animation-delay:0s}.particle-2[data-astro-cid-bbe6dxrz]{top:60%;left:80%;animation-delay:2s}.particle-3[data-astro-cid-bbe6dxrz]{top:30%;left:60%;animation-delay:4s}.particle-4[data-astro-cid-bbe6dxrz]{top:80%;left:30%;animation-delay:6s}.particle-5[data-astro-cid-bbe6dxrz]{top:40%;left:90%;animation-delay:8s}@keyframes float-particle{0%,to{transform:translate(0);opacity:.3}50%{transform:translate(50px,-100px);opacity:.6}}.bg-grid-pattern[data-astro-cid-bbe6dxrz]{background-image:linear-gradient(to right,#000 1px,transparent 1px),linear-gradient(to bottom,#000 1px,transparent 1px);background-size:40px 40px}.headline-word[data-astro-cid-bbe6dxrz]{display:inline-block;opacity:0;transform:translateY(20px);animation:fade-in-up .8s cubic-bezier(.16,1,.3,1) forwards;animation-delay:var(--delay, 0s)}@keyframes fade-in-up{to{opacity:1;transform:translateY(0)}}.subline-text[data-astro-cid-bbe6dxrz]{opacity:0;transform:translateY(10px);animation:fade-in-up .8s cubic-bezier(.16,1,.3,1) forwards;animation-delay:.5s}.badge-container[data-astro-cid-bbe6dxrz]{opacity:0;transform:scale(.9);animation:badge-appear .6s cubic-bezier(.34,1.56,.64,1) forwards}@keyframes badge-appear{to{opacity:1;transform:scale(1)}}.cta-container[data-astro-cid-bbe6dxrz]{opacity:0;transform:translateY(10px);animation:fade-in-up .8s cubic-bezier(.16,1,.3,1) forwards;animation-delay:.7s}.cta-button[data-astro-cid-bbe6dxrz]{position:relative;box-shadow:0 20px 40px -10px #3b82f666}.cta-button[data-astro-cid-bbe6dxrz]:before{content:"";position:absolute;inset:-2px;background:linear-gradient(135deg,#3b82f6,#06b6d4,#0ea5e9);border-radius:inherit;opacity:0;transition:opacity .3s;z-index:-1}.cta-button[data-astro-cid-bbe6dxrz]:hover:before{opacity:.3}.trust-badge[data-astro-cid-bbe6dxrz]{display:flex;align-items:center;padding:.625rem 1rem;background:linear-gradient(135deg,#ffffffe6,#ffffffb3);backdrop-filter:blur(10px);border-radius:.75rem;font-size:.875rem;font-weight:500;color:#374151;box-shadow:0 4px 15px #0000000d;opacity:0;transform:translateY(10px);animation:fade-in-up .6s cubic-bezier(.16,1,.3,1) forwards;transition:all .3s ease}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(1){animation-delay:.8s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(2){animation-delay:.9s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(3){animation-delay:1s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(4){animation-delay:1.05s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(5){animation-delay:1.1s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(6){animation-delay:1.15s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(7){animation-delay:1.2s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(8){animation-delay:1.25s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(9){animation-delay:1.3s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(10){animation-delay:1.35s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(11){animation-delay:1.4s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(12){animation-delay:1.45s}.trust-badge[data-astro-cid-bbe6dxrz]:nth-child(13){animation-delay:1.5s}.trust-badge[data-astro-cid-bbe6dxrz]:hover{transform:translateY(-2px);box-shadow:0 8px 25px #0000001a}.badges-container[data-astro-cid-bbe6dxrz]{mask-image:linear-gradient(to right,transparent,black 15%,black 85%,transparent);-webkit-mask-image:linear-gradient(to right,transparent,black 15%,black 85%,transparent)}.badges-mobile-marquee[data-astro-cid-bbe6dxrz]{max-height:5.5rem;overflow:hidden;position:relative}.badges-track[data-astro-cid-bbe6dxrz]{display:inline-flex;flex-wrap:nowrap;gap:1.25rem;animation:slow-scroll-horizontal 80s linear infinite;white-space:nowrap}@keyframes slow-scroll-horizontal{0%{transform:translate(0)}to{transform:translate(-50%)}}.preview-container[data-astro-cid-bbe6dxrz]{opacity:0;transform:translateY(30px);animation:fade-in-up 1s cubic-bezier(.16,1,.3,1) forwards;animation-delay:1.1s}.perspective-container[data-astro-cid-bbe6dxrz]{perspective:2000px}.preview-card[data-astro-cid-bbe6dxrz]{transform-style:preserve-3d;transition:transform .6s cubic-bezier(.16,1,.3,1)}.preview-card[data-astro-cid-bbe6dxrz]:hover{transform:translateY(-10px) rotateX(2deg)}@media (max-width: 640px){.gradient-orb[data-astro-cid-bbe6dxrz]{filter:blur(60px);opacity:.3}}
